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"sickness practice" is not commonly used in written English and may be unclear in meaning.
It could potentially be used in contexts discussing practices related to illness or healthcare, but it lacks clarity without additional context. Example: "The clinic focuses on sickness practice, providing comprehensive care for patients with chronic conditions."

Ludwig's WRAP-UP
In summary, the phrase "sickness practice" is a relatively uncommon term used to describe the management or treatment of illnesses. While grammatically acceptable, Ludwig AI notes its limited usage in written English. Its contexts lean towards formal and scientific domains, but more common alternatives like "illness management" or "healthcare management" may provide better clarity and recognition. When using "sickness practice", ensure the context is clear and consider whether a more widely understood phrase would be more effective.

FAQs
How can I use "sickness practice" in a sentence?
While not very common, "sickness practice" can refer to established methods of dealing with illnesses. For example: "The clinic focuses on evidence-based "illness management" in its sickness practice."
What is a more common alternative to "sickness practice"?
Alternatives include "healthcare management", which is more general, or "illness management", which focuses specifically on handling sickness.
Is "sickness practice" a formal or informal term?
"Sickness practice" leans towards a neutral to slightly formal register but lacks widespread usage. Using terms like "medical protocols" or "clinical procedures" may be more appropriate in professional contexts.
What does "sickness practice" encompass?
It can encompass the strategies, procedures, and established methods employed in dealing with illnesses. It may refer to both preventative measures and treatment protocols, though it's more often associated with active management of existing conditions rather than prevention.
